Child was playing around his dead parents bodies, thinking they were asleep

It was a heartbreaking scene at Munirabad railway station of Koppal district on Monday morning (Aug 22). The three-year-old boy was playing beside the bodies of his dead parents thinking that they were just asleep.

According to TOI report, when a few suspicious passengers questioned the boy, he told them that they were to visit Huligemma temple, once mom and dad woke up.  He was wandering around the station, waiting for them to get up.

When the passengers checked on the parents, they realized that the couple were dead and reported it to the railway police. When the boy innocently said that the parents were asleep, passengers and even the policemen couldn’t control their tears.

The police identified the deceased as Iranna Talawar, 50, and Manjula, 40, residents of Annigeri and now settled in Gadag. “We contacted some their relatives through the contact list on their mobile phone,” RS Kotagi, PSI, Gadag Railway Police.

Iranna and Manjula and their son Devaraj boarded the train to Koppal from Gadag. When they arrived at Munirabad station, they stayed there and slept on the platform. On Monday morning, the couple were found dead under mysterious circumstances.

“Prima facie, it looks like suicide case, but we are not sure whether they consumed poison or something else. We don’t know the exact reason for their death. It will be clear after we get the postmortem reports,” said Kotagi.

“We have handed over the bodies to the district hospital for postmortem and informed their relatives to take the boy. If no one comes forward, the boy will be handed over to the Child Protection Committee,” he added.
